Safety Information

This chapter contains important information on safe and efficient operation. Please read this
information before using the device.
Exposure to Radio Frequency (RF) Energy
The device contains a transmitter and a receiver. When it is ON, it receives and transmits RF
energy. Please use the device appropriately.

Road Safety
Check the laws and regulations on the use of phones in the area where you drive. Do NOT use this
device unless you use hands-free operation while driving or riding.
Potentially Explosive Atmospheres
Turn off your phone prior to entering any area with a potentially explosive atmosphere such as gas
stations, explosive chemicals, or flammable objects.
Aircraft Safety
While in flight, switch the device to flight mode (turn off phone or wireless functions). When
instructed to do so, turn off your phone when on board an aircraft.
Facilities
Turn off the device in any facility where posted notices instruct you to do so. These facilities may
include hospitals or health care facilities that may be using equipment that is sensitive to external
RF energy.
Approved Accessories and Batteries
Use only original or manufacturer approved accessories, batteries and chargers.
